Attending the Internship Showcase is a great way to learn about this award-winning school and about the educational programs that keep students engaged and learning. Thirty-seven students have worked on one of six Youth Conservation Corps (YCC) crews: Archaeology, Eco Monitoring, Murals, Watershed Keepers, ALCS Garden, and Trails. The remaining students have been learning various skills by working with mentors in careers such as information technology, lab assistant, pre-school education, county government, construction, veterinarian, and native plants. All interns will give presentations about their internship or YCC experience.

One of the most common misconceptions about ALCS is that you have to pay to attend. ALCS is a public school with grades 6 through 12, and it is open to all residents of New Mexico.
